Upon what do redevelopment agencies spend their money?

0

The West Sacramento Redevelopment Agency has spent its redevelopment funds on new projects such as the Ziggurat, Raley Field and the Riverwalk Park and to finance the operations of the Redevelopment Agency itself. Statewide, approximately 2/3 of redevelopment funds are spent on improving streets, streetlights, landscaping, sidewalks, parking lots, sewer and water systems and other public infrastructure. The balance of the funds are used for housing rehabilitation or construction, land acquisition, development assistance, administration and operational expenses. Every expenditure by the agency must benefit the redevelopment project area that generates the funding. Redevelopment funds cannot be used to subsidize normal city services such as police services, fire protection or maintenance services.
